In honor of October, Rich (singlebanana) and Shawn (GrayGhost81) chose to play the modern, 8-bit Castlevania-like, Bloodstained: Curse of the Moon.  This episode, the guys discuss the gameplay, the graphics, the music, and whether this is a title you should add to your collection. Our monthly segment of the ConcertCast returns and includes reviews of some great shows that the guys attended. They also devote a nice portion of the show to discussing all of the horror movies they watched this Halloween season. Video games are expensive products to make. The multi-million dollar project is not uncommon in the modern game development industry, in fact it's become the standard. It's like proclaiming the cost of production is some kind of bragging right owed to the developer. But now it's become popular to discuss how minuscule a game's team was or how it was made of a six figure budget.
